What is a dressing room?
A dressing room is a role playing community where you can pick up any character you like and play them right away--like trying on a set of clothes.
What kind of characters can I play here?
This is a Supernatural themed dressing room. As a result, all characters should originate from or be based on characters in the Supernatural universe. You can play regular Sam or Dean from any season you like, vampire!Castiel, rule!63 Jack, grown up Ben, a human version of the Impala, AU!Baker!Charlie etc etc. The only limit is your imagination. The character can be real or invented, have a detailed backstory or not--it's entirely up to you.
So does this mean I can play original characters?
If they're based on the Supernatural universe, absolutely.
But wait, does this mean I have to play with other people's OCs?
Not if you don't want to. In fact, it's up to you who you RP with. If you don't want to play with someone don't play with them. Nobody's going to hold your hand, but we do expect you to be nice to each other and play by the rules.
Does this mean there will be repeats of canon characters? Can't I make a face claim?
There's plenty of places where you can choose to play just one character and ring fence that character for yourself. In a dressing room, dozens of people can play Dean Winchester if they want to, and they can come and go as much as they want to. Part of the fun is to find new exciting twists on characters, though, so why not give it a try?

What is the setting?
The setting of this dressing room is what's known as a nexus. In canon terms it's a little like Supernatural's Heaven, with or without the doors, a series of different environments which are mysteriously linked. Traveling the nexus is as much will as anything else.
The mods propose a weekly setting change for the "main" part of the nexus, which you can use or not as you will. Beyond that everything is in a state of flux, forming psychically out of the efforts of the characters and muns involved. If your character was just in a forest, then it can be a forest. If you want an alien spaceship or a beach or anything else, the nexus forms around that need, and your character can control that as much as you want or need them to. Want them to wake up in a haunted house they've never seen before? Want to start a thread as Crowley where other players' characters wake up on his table? That's totally your call. You choose the setting, and if other people don't like it they don't have to tag in.

Can I play a continuing storyline?
Of course, though be sure to keep your threadmates up to speed. Dressing room continuity can be weird because you might be playing three different scenarios at the same time. I like to imagine it's a series of alternate timelines that you can either merge into one or pick and choose which things you want to stick with your character as their RP lives go on.
Are my characters trapped here? Are they aware they're in this nexus?
If they need to be. It's up to you! These are hunters we're talking about, they're good at figuring out the truth of their reality. Please be clear with other players, though. If someone is playing a new character discovering the nexus, they might not want to be "saved" and inundated with all the secrets of their new environment. Tread lightly! Make it fun!
What about NSFW content?
NSFW content is allowed! NSFW setting starters should be behind a cut and marked appropriately. If a thread goes NSFW both players need to agree to it and one of the players needs to change the comment subject to NSFW. The player who started the thread needs to change the post's age restriction to 18+.
